Lady Statesmen Open GSC Play at Home Versus UAH, UWA

CLEVELAND, Miss. - The Delta State University women's soccer team is scheduled to officially open its home and Gulf South Conference slates when it faces Alabama Huntsville on Friday, Sept. 8 at 2 p.m., before finishing the weekend with a 2 p.m. contest against the University of West Alabama on Sunday, Sept. 10.

INSIDE THE SERIES:
  • UAH leads the series 12-2.
  • Both DSU wins in the series came on the road. 
  • UAH scored a pair of second half goals in a 3-1 win last season.
  • UWA leads the series 7-1.
  • West Alabama scored two goals in each half in a 4-0 victory last year.
 
ABOUT DSU:
  • The Lady Statesmen enter play 0-2, after dropping a pair of neutral site contests to Heartland Conference foes Texas A&M International and St. Mary's.
  • Three different players have scored for DSU this season. Traci Monroe scored her second career goal, while senior Abigail Smith and freshman Jasmine McGill recorded their first goals at DSU.
  • McGill leads the Lady Statesmen with seven shots, while Monroe and Smith have two apiece.
  • Ana Branch, had seven saves in the loss to Texas A&M International, while Ella Hunkin stepped in and had six stops.
 
ABOUT UAH:
  • The Chargers enter play 1-1, including a 1-0 home setback in the opener to McKendree and a 3-1 victory over Tusculum.
  • UAH is 1-4 in its last five GSC openers.
  • Three different players have scored for the Chargers.
  • UAH keeper Megan Buford has made 13 stops in two games.
 
ABOUT UWA:
  • UWA also enters the weekend 1-1 as it suffered a 3-0 home loss to Tusculum, before bouncing back with a 1-0 win over St. Leo. The Tigers are scheduled to face Mississippi College on Friday Sept. 8.
  • Anele Komani was named GSC Freshman of the week after scoring the winner against St. Leo.
  • Marie Dreezen leads the Tigers with five shots.
  • Jenni Aarniva has started in goal for both UWA games, and has 13 saves.
 
UP NEXT: The Lady Statesmen are scheduled to face their first GSC road tests when they visit Lee on Friday, Sept. 15, before finishing the weekend at Shorter on Sunday, Sept. 17.
